Age of Baby – Soft spout cups for beginners; straw or 360° cups for older toddlers.
Material – BPA-free plastic or stainless steel for safety and durability.
Spill-Proof Design – Look for leak-proof valves for mess-free use.
Ease of Cleaning – Fewer detachable parts are easier to wash and sterilize.
Handles vs. Handle-Free – Handles help babies grip better during the early stages.
Q1: When should I introduce a sippy cup to my baby?
Most babies can start using sippy cups at around 6 months, when they begin solids.
Q2: Should I choose straw or spout cups?
Spout cups are great for starters, while straw cups support oral muscle development.
Q3: Are sippy cups safe for teeth?
Yes, as long as you avoid prolonged sipping on sugary drinks. Use water or milk.
Q4: Can sippy cups go in the sterilizer?
Yes, most are sterilizer-safe. Always check manufacturer instructions.
